- 博客(19)
- 收藏
- 关注
原创 json格式数据展示在页面上
模板里面<el-dialog :visible.sync="dialogVisible" width="30%" title="消息详情"> <el-input type="textarea" :value="message" class="dialog-style" readonly rows="10" ></el-input> <span sl.
2022-03-01 13:29:20
2339
原创 hash,history,高阶函数,内存泄漏,margin塌陷
1.hash路由和history路由的区别: 1.hash路由在地址栏URL上有#,而history路由没有#,并且更精简 2.进行回车刷新操作,hash路由会加载到地址栏对应的页面,而history路由一般就404报错了 (刷新是网络请求,history路由需要后端支持)。 3.hash路由支持低版本的浏览器,而history路由是HTML5新增的API。 4.hash的特点在于它虽然出现在了URL中,但是不包括在http请求中,所以对于后端是...
2021-10-21 23:10:28
205
原创 ajax的使用
1.原生js的使用<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title&g
2021-10-16 17:35:28
145
原创 es6+css选择器
1.简述css3选择器的优先级机制 css权重计算得到:ID选择器》class,属性,伪类》标签,伪元素1000 100 10 1 如果权重相同,那么以定义顺序靠近的选择器优先,或者有!importent标记的优先(0,0,0,0)(行内样式,ID选择器数量,class,属性,伪类数量,标签,伪元素数量)...
2021-10-08 09:25:38
542
原创 es6学习中遇到的问题+复习题
1.node英文官网为什么可以自己识别电脑系统 因为系统名放在请求头里 user-agent2.闭包 函数内部包裹函数,指有权访问另一个函数作用域变量形成的函数 全局变量可以访问函数内部局部变量 延申了变量的作用范围 也就是改变了作用域 不会马上销毁函数局部变量 作用域链得不到释放3.js中有六种数据类型,包括五种基本数据类型(number,string,boolean,undefined,null),和一种复杂数据...
2021-09-27 22:47:28
156
原创 js中遇到的问题
数组的reverse()和sort()方法没有必要的联系,所以reverse的值不一定和sort的值是相反的;reverse只是针对原来的数组来说的。
2021-09-24 09:09:50
73
原创 js易混淆题目总结笔记
1.innerHTML普通元素内容,里面的标签正常输出,不会自动对文本进行编码和解码。innerText纯文本内容jQuery:html()text()val()2.jQuery下的:remove()该方法不会把匹配的元素从 jQuery 对象中删除,因而可以在将来再使用这些匹配的元素。 但除了这个元素本身得以保留之外,remove() 不会保留元素的 jQuery 数据。其他的比如绑定的事件...
2021-09-23 22:08:49
126
原创 js易混淆点
1.var n=parseInt(span.innerHTML)为什么不用Number()转换。 答:parseInt()和parseFloat()是专门将字符串转为数字类型的函数。且parseInt()和parseFloat可自动去掉数字后非数字字符,不如px单位。而Number()无此功能,比较弱。所以,今后,能用parseInt()或parseFloat()都用parseInt()和parseFloat()。2.if(btn.innerHTML=="+"){ n...
2021-09-15 16:19:16
127
原创 DOM总结
1.什么是DOM? 专门操作网页内容的一套函数和对象 DOM还是一个标准,由W3C制定广义JS=ECMAScipt+DOM+BOM 核心语法 +操作网页内容+访问浏览器软件(与网页无关)要想操作网页内容,为页面添加交互效果,其实只能用DOM函数和对象 包括:5件事 增删改查 事件绑定2.DOM树 在内存中,集中保存一个网页中所有内容的树形结构 突出上下级包含关...
2021-09-14 22:22:50
274
原创 css部分属性(flex,animation,transition,transform)总结
就是一个网站能够兼容多个终端——而不是为每个终端做一个特定的版本。
2021-09-08 08:53:13
373
原创 css核心属性,特有属性,自定义属性,form的enctype属性
css有三种属性,包括核心属性,特有属性,自定义属性。1.核心属性默认只有四个:id,class,style,title。title 属性规定关于元素的额外信息。这些信息通常会在鼠标移到元素上时显示一段工具提示文本(tooltip text)。在 HTML5 中, title 属性可用于任何的 HTML 元素 (它会验证任何HTML元素。但不一定是有用)。语法:<element title="text">2.特有属性:如src,href,alt等。3.自定义属性常和j
2021-08-26 15:58:34
338
原创 二级导航栏鼠标移到下面就消失问题
<!DOCTYPE html><html><head><style>.dropdown { position: relative; /*display: inline-block;*/}.dropdown-content { display: none; position: absolute; background-color: #f9f9f9; min-width: 160px; box-shadow: 0px 8p...
2021-08-24 14:47:59
783
原创 css选择器,优先级,样式继承
CSS选择器 (1)标签选择器(元素选择器) 标签选择器又叫元素选择器,使用元素名可以直接选中相同的元素 (2)类名选择器 类选择器以.开头,后面紧跟类名 不允许有空格 与元素的class属性值保持一致 一个元素可以有多个class值 每个值之间通过空格分开 (3)ID选择器 id选择器以#开头,后面紧跟id名 不允许有空格 与元素的id属性值保持一致 在一个文档中 id值不能重复 所以这个一般选择唯一元素 (4)普遍选择器...
2021-08-23 19:19:53
143
原创 css易混淆的点和遇到的问题
(1)body>div:nth-chlid(2)表示body的第二个孩子;(2)background-size:cover;/*只会拉伸成一张图片,可能会溢出*/background-Size:contain;/*按图片的宽高拉伸,可能不止一张图片*/(3)因为table>tbody>tr>td,tbody可以省略 所以table tr>td,并不是table>tr>tdtr不用设置border,展...
2021-08-10 19:44:56
115
原创 Html开发需要的环境
1.vi、vim、记事本 VS Code 微软开发的 支持多系统 开源 内置了扩展程序的管理功能 使用方便 可以汉化 Sublime 但是,他的插件安装很困难 、、、2.浏览器 Chrome\Firefox 有比较强大的代码调试工具 有一些好用的浏览器插件 作用: 1. 用于读取html文件,并将其作为网页显示 2. 用于调试代码3.Httpd服务器 ...
2021-08-02 22:02:35
2458
原创 http,https,url
http:超文本传输协议(Hyper Text Transfer Protocol,HTTP)是一个简单的请求-响应协议,它通常运行在TCP之上。它指定了客户端可能发送给服务器什么样的消息以及得到什么样的响应。HTTP是基于B/S架构进行通信的请求:请求头、url、协议、参数响应:响应状态码 响应内容 ...HTTP协议工作于客户端-服务端架构上。浏览器作为HTTP客户端通过URL向HTTP服务端即WEB服务器发送所有请求。htmlhttpshttp+ss...
2021-07-28 19:23:19
1358
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人